A complete guide to understanding, developing, and testing popular security-token smart contractsKey FeaturesUnderstand key Blockchain and Ethereum platforms conceptsStep-by-step guide to developing STO smart contracts on EthereumMonetize digital tokens under various U.S. securities lawsBook DescriptionThe failure of initial coin offerings (ICOs) is no accident, as most ICOs do not link to a real asset and are not regulated. Realizing the shortcomings of ICOs, the blockchain community and potential investors embraced security token offerings (STOs) and stablecoins enthusiastically.In this book, we start with an overview of the blockchain technology along with its basic concepts. We introduce the concept behind STO, and cover the basic requirements for launching a STO and the relevant regulations governing its issuance. We discuss U.S. securities laws development in launching security digital tokens using blockchain technology and show some real use cases. We also explore the process of STO launches and legal considerations. We introduce popular security tokens in the current blockchain space and talk about how to develop a security token DApp, including smart contract development for ERC1404 tokens. Later, you'll learn to build frontend side functionalities to interact with smart contracts. Finally, we discuss stablecoin technical design functionalities for issuing and operating STO tokens by interacting with Ethereum smart contracts.By the end of this book, you will have learned more about STOs and gained a detailed knowledge of building relevant applications-all with the help of practical examples.What you will learnUnderstand the basic requirements for launching a security token offeringExplore various US securities laws governing the offering of security digital tokensGet to grips with the stablecoin concept with the help of use casesLearn how to develop security token decentralized applicationsUnderstand the difference between ERC-20 and ERC-721 tokensLearn how to set up a development environment and build security tokensExplore the technical design of stablecoinsWho this book is forThis book is ideal for blockchain beginners and business user developers who want to quickly master popular Security Token Offerings and stablecoins. Readers will learn how to develop blockchain/digital cryptos, guided by U.S. securities laws and utilizing some real use cases. Prior exposure to an Object-Oriented Programming language such as JavaScript would be an advantage, but is not mandatory.

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- Starting from Newton's times this follow-up to the author's Springer book 'Our Place in the Universe - Understanding Fundamental Astronomy from Ancient Discoveries' addresses the question of 'our place in the Universe' from astronomical, physical, chemical, biological, philosophical and social perspectives.Using the history of astronomy to illustrate the process of discovery, the emphasis is on the description of the process of how we learned and on the exploration of the impacts of discoveries rather than on the presentation of facts. Thus readers are informed of the influence of science on a broad scale.Unlike the traditional way of teaching science, in this book, the author begins by describing the observations and then discusses various attempts to find answers (including unsuccessful ones). The goal is to help students develop a better appreciation of the scientific process and learn from this process to tackle real-life problems.
